That is the image of Trump Phoenix business owner, Beatrice Moore, wants to send to her community. Moore recently paid a California artist to render a Nazi-esque billboard of President Trump. The horrible rendering depicts the president wearing a Russian lapel pin, with mushroom clouds behind him and dollar signs morphed into swastikas on each side of him.

When ABC15 asked Moore about the sign that is stirring up emotions in the city, she said it was about “standing up to the “disturbing policies of the Trump administration.” She also said she plans to keep the billboard up as long as Trump remains in the White House.

While some residents support Moore’s right to express her concerns, others feel it is a blatant show of disrespect to the president. They also feel it is painful reminder of one of the darkest times in world history.
